I have richmond and there is no noise.
If there is noise they were not installed correctly.
Make sure you have someone experianced with gen3 rears and the gear setup's do the insatll as it may save you some heartache.
I heard the same thing about richmond gears but after a yukon gear nightmare I went to jegs for the richmonds and have been very happy with them.

i think i will go with motive... thanks guys, o appreciate it. what kind of break in procedure do gears call for, never had any replaced

1st let me say when you do a gear swap, Make sure you buy a master rebuild kit and change all your bearings and seals.
First use regular gear oil with no posi additive. Then You need to heat quench the gears 3 or 4 times (drive about 10 miles, then stop for at least an hour to cool the rear end lube), then take it easy for a few hundred miles, varying your speed and don't go over 65 mph. After 500 miles change your rear end oil preferably with red line or royal purple (you wont need posi additive with these 2) if you use regular gear oil you will need posi additive. While the cover is off look over everything and do a torque check on all the bolts (the shop that did your gears should do this for free as a part of the gear swap) Then give her hell!!!
